Crafting the Perfect Offer Letter: A Guide for Indian Startups
Securing top talent has become in the success of any startup. When you're ready to extend an offer to your ideal candidate, crafting a compelling and clear offer letter is essential. This document serves as a formal proposition outlining the terms of employment and sets the stage for a successful journey.
A well-crafted offer letter should be concise, respectful in tone, and explicitly outline the key aspects of the employment package.
It's crucial to mention details such as salary structure, benefits, work location, start date, and any other key information. Remember, a strong offer letter not only incentivizes talent but also reflects your startup's professionalism and commitment to its workforce.
Streamlining Employee Onboarding in India: Best Practices & Tools
Effective onboarding is a vital role in setting the stage for employee success and engagement. In India's dynamic business landscape, where talent is continuously competitive, streamlining the onboarding process emerges crucial. A well-structured onboarding program not only introduces new hires but also strengthens a sense of belonging and equips them for long-term contribution.
To achieve this, organizations should implement best practices that are tailored to the Indian context. Key essential elements include:
* Organizing a thorough orientation session that covers company culture, values, policies, and procedures.
* Giving clear role expectations and performance standards.
* Establishing a mentorship program to assist new hires in their integration into the organization.
By embracing these best practices and employing appropriate onboarding tools, Indian companies can enhance the employee experience from day one and set the foundation for a successful workforce.

Comprehending Probation Confirmation Letters in India
Probation confirmation letters are crucial documents provided to employees who have successfully completed their probationary period in this region. These letters formally confirm the employee's movement from a probationary role to a permanent position within the organization. Receiving a probation confirmation letter is a important milestone in an employee's career, indicating their competence and suitability for the job.
It is important for employees to meticulously review the terms and conditions outlined in the probation confirmation letter, as it may specify details about salary, benefits, job responsibilities, and other pertinent information.
In case an employee has any queries regarding the content of the letter, they should without delay speak with their manager.
A Comprehensive Indian Offer Letter Template
Securing the ideal individual for your organization involves crafting a compelling and comprehensive offer letter. In India, specific legal requirements and cultural nuances shape the content of an offer letter. We'll explore the essential elements that comprise a standard Indian offer letter template to ensure clarity and fulfillment with relevant regulations.
- First and foremost, the offer letter ought to clearly state the role the candidate is being offered.
- Furthermore, it ought to specify the salary and benefits, including basic salary, allowances, and other perks.
- Thirdly, a detailed explanation of the candidate's responsibilities within the role is crucial.
- Additionally, the offer letter must mention the duration of the employment contract, along with any conditions pertaining termination.
, Ultimately, an Indian offer letter should fulfill all applicable labor laws and regulations. Consulting a legal expert is suggested to ensure the offer letter is legally sound and protects the interests of both parties.

Managing probation periods effectively is crucial for both employers and employees in India. During this initial phase, organizations can assess an employee's alignment with the role and company culture, while employees get a chance to adjust into the work environment. Clearly defined probationary periods, coupled with frequent performance evaluations and feedback, are key to facilitating a smooth transition.
Open communication between managers and probationary employees is paramount. Regular meetings should be scheduled to discuss progress, address concerns, and provide guidance. Moreover, organizations should provide comprehensive training and development opportunities to help probationers develop their skills and knowledge.
- Introduce a well-structured probationary agreement outlining expectations, performance metrics, and consequences for unsatisfactory performance.
- Conduct formal performance reviews at regular intervals throughout the probation period.
- Offer constructive feedback, both positive and negative, to help employees improve.
- Cultivate a supportive work environment that encourages open communication and collaboration.
